Invoices that come in missing a PO number, without a clear description of services, or with the wrong billing address sit in an approval queue while someone tracks down the missing information. A structured invoice form eliminates that back-and-forth by ensuring contractors submit everything needed for processing in one go.

This template captures the contractor's name and business details, the client name and billing address, a project or PO reference number, the invoice date and payment due date, an itemized list of services with hours and rates or fixed fees, any expenses to be reimbursed, the total amount due, banking details for direct transfer, and an optional notes field for any relevant context.

Contractor Invoice Form Template FAQs:

Your business name and contact details, the client's name and billing address, a unique invoice number, the invoice date, a clear description of services rendered, the amount for each line item, the total due, your payment terms, and your bank or payment details. Missing any of these consistently lengthens the time to payment.

Use separate line items — one section for services at your hourly or daily rate, and a separate section for expenses to be reimbursed. For expenses, attach receipts in the upload field. This makes it easy for the client's finance team to approve each component separately if their policy requires it.

State the due date clearly — 'Net 30 from receipt' is common. For project-based work, you might use milestone-based terms. Some contractors add early payment discounts (2/10 net 30) or late payment fees. Whatever your terms are, they should be consistent across all your invoices and ideally agreed to in the contract before work begins.

Include a contact name and email for billing queries on the form. If a client disputes a line item, the documented submission and any supporting timesheet or expense records provide the basis for resolution. Keep clear records of all work performed — they're your evidence if a dispute escalates.
